  2. 3 de may. de 2024 · Coupling refers to the degree of interdependence between software modules. High coupling means that modules are closely connected and changes in one module may affect other modules. Low coupling means that modules are independent, and changes in one module have little impact on other modules. Coupling.

  7. 13 de may. de 2024 · The term coupling can be understood as the impact that a change in one component will have on other components. In the end, it is related to the amount of things that a given component shares with others. The more is shared, the more tight is the coupling.
